Department of the Interior Office of the Secretary 43 CFR Part 11 [Docket No. DOI-2022-0016; 4500176944] RIN 1090-AB26 AGENCY: Office of Restoration and Damage Assessment, Interior. ACTION: Notice of proposed rulemaking; request for public comment. SUMMARY: The Office of Restoration and Damage Assessment is seeking comments and suggestions from State, Tribal, and Federal natural resource co-trustees, other affected parties, and the interested public on revising the simplified Type A procedures in the regulations for conducting natural resource damage assessment and restoration for hazardous substance releases. DATES: We will accept comments through March 5, 2024.
